Hydroxychloroquine is an antimalarial medication also used to treat autoimmune diseases like lupus and rheumatoid arthritis. It works by reducing inflammation and suppressing the immune system.

Hydroxychloroquine Sulfate FAQ


What is hydroxychloroquine primarily used for?

It treats malaria, lupus, and rheumatoid arthritis by reducing inflammation and immune response.

How does hydroxychloroquine work?

It interferes with immune cells, reducing inflammation and alleviating autoimmune disease symptoms.

Is hydroxychloroquine safe for long-term use?

Generally safe under medical supervision, but regular eye exams are crucial to prevent retinal damage.

What are common side effects of hydroxychloroquine?

Nausea, diarrhea, stomach cramps, headache, and rare but serious eye problems.

Can hydroxychloroquine be used during pregnancy?

May be used if benefits outweigh risks; consult a doctor for personalized advice.

How is hydroxychloroquine administered?

Orally, with or without food, as prescribed by a healthcare provider.

What is the typical dosage for malaria prevention?

Varies by weight, travel destination, and malaria strain; follow doctor's instructions.

Does hydroxychloroquine interact with other medications?

Yes, may interact with antacids, immunosuppressants, and certain antibiotics; inform your doctor.

Is hydroxychloroquine effective for COVID-19?

Not recommended; studies show limited efficacy and potential risks outside clinical trials.

Can hydroxychloroquine cause sun sensitivity?

Yes, avoid prolonged sun exposure and use sunscreen while taking the medication.

How long does it take for hydroxychloroquine to work for lupus?

May take several weeks to notice symptom improvement; consistent use is essential.

What happens if a dose is missed?

Take the missed dose as soon as remembered, but skip if close to the next scheduled dose.

Can hydroxychloroquine be crushed or chewed?

Swallow tablets whole; consult a pharmacist if swallowing difficulties occur.

Is hydroxychloroquine habit-forming?

No, it is not classified as a habit-forming medication.

How should hydroxychloroquine be stored?

Store at room temperature, away from moisture and heat, in the original container.
